The Roots of Barbering



Discovering the origins of barbering exposes an abundant history linked with culture and tradition. The technique of barbering go back to ancient times when barbers not just reduce hair but likewise executed surgical procedures and dental treatments. In old Egypt, barbers were very regarded for their abilities in haircutting and shaving, often working with aristocrats and pharaohs.

The occupation progressed over the centuries, with hair salons becoming social centers where men collected to review politics, sports, and daily life. Barbering spread around the world, adapting to different cultures and customs along the road. In middle ages times, barbers likewise served as dentists and specialists, utilizing their devices for various treatments. The iconic barber pole, with its red and white spirals, represents the blood and plasters made use of in these early clinical practices.

As time passed, barbers concentrated more on hair cutting and pet grooming, establishing their very own unique strategies and designs. Today, barbers continue to honor their heritage by blending contemporary fads with old-time traditions, supplying not simply haircuts yet a total grooming experience deeply rooted in history.
